Create a Customizable Snow Effect with ActionScript 3.0

It’s been a cold winter all over the place, so let’s recognize that fact with a nice wintery scene. In this tutorial we will create a falling snow effect using Flash and ActionScript 3.0.

Final Result
Let’s take a quick look at the final effect:

Step 1: Brief Overview
Using an image as a background we will create a falling snow effect. The snow will be a user defined MovieClip that will be exported to be used as a class. We will duplicate and animate this clip with AS3.
Step 2: Set Up
Open Flash and create a new Flash File (ActionScript 3.0).

Set the stage size to 500 x 375 px and set the frame rate to 24fps.

Step 3: Getting the Background
A snowy scene will be required for this effect.
You can create your own or adapt a custom background. In this example I used a photograph…
